Transaction 2b95615862b07bccc4446837cd8977e0fc53a7b7009245402f3456b4b92c555f
1 Input
1 Output
-
2b95615862b07bccc4446837cd8977e0fc53a7b7009245402f3456b4b92c555f:0
- value
- 10978313
- script pubkey
- OP_0 OP_PUSHBYTES_20 521e1db57f17abdc487c7aa40319c133806cdf72
- address
- bc1q2g0pmdtlz74acjru02jqxxwpxwqxehmjtl630y